Image pipes VOXL2
-
I wrote a script that opens and reads a pipe, however, I cannot seem to find the image pipes for the cameras. I am new to FIFO pipes, can someone help me where I can find the image pipe for the hires camera on VOXL2?

@martongonczy https://docs.modalai.com/mpa-camera-interface/
All MPA pipes live in
/run/mpa, e.g./run/mpa/hires -

I can only see these pipes in that directory. I managed to retrieve data from voxl-tflite-server0, however that is for the tflite-server and I cannot find the pipe for the hires camera without the tflite overlay.
Could it be that I forgot to start a service? -

Could it be that I forgot to start a service?@martongonczy You'll need to use an MPA based client in order to read from the pipe, like in
voxl-inspect-cam: https://gitlab.com/voxl-public/voxl-sdk/utilities/voxl-mpa-tools/-/blob/master/tools/voxl-inspect-cam.c?ref_type=headswhat you're seeing is voxl-tflite-server reading from the hires pipe
